To help students capture credit on upcoming Retake and Final Exams, MNS Tutoring is proud to offer the Saturday Group Sessions series. These sessions are open to any student taking the specified course(s). We prioritize fundamental concepts that need reinforcement before facing them again on the final exam.
Many teachers will use the mark on the Final exam to replace the student's lowest exam mark earlier in the year if the Final exam mark is higher. Our Saturday Group Sessions can help!
Each Saturday Group session is recorded. Participating students can watch the recording whenever their schedule permits and email us with any questions they have.
